Metacarpal fractures refer to breaks in the long bones of the hand, specifically those that connect the wrist to the fingers. These fractures can occur in any one of the five metacarpal bones, which are typically numbered from the thumb (first) to the little finger (fifth). This type of injury is quite common, often classified as a result of trauma, such as falls, sports injuries, or direct blows to the hand. A notable cause of metacarpal fractures is a “boxer's fracture,” which commonly occurs when a person punches a hard object, leading to the fracture of the fifth metacarpal near its neck. In terms of symptoms, individuals with metacarpal fractures may experience immediate pain, swelling, bruising, and difficulty moving the affected fingers. Deformity may also be present, especially with more severe fractures. The examination generally includes visual assessment and palpation of the area, alongside imaging studies like X-rays to confirm the diagnosis and determine the fracture pattern. Treatment options differ depending on the severity and type of fracture. For non-displaced fractures, conservative management may involve immobilization with a splint or cast to allow the bone to heal correctly. In cases where the fracture is displaced or involves the bone's joint surface, surgical intervention might be required to realign the bones using plates and screws, ensuring proper healing and function post-recovery. Rehabilitation exercises are often initiated after the initial healing phase to help regain strength and motion in the hand. Long-term complications can include stiffness, persistent pain, or reduced grip strength, making early diagnosis and appropriate management crucial to restore normal hand function. Preventive measures, such as using protective gear during high-risk activities and practicing safe techniques in sports or physical activities, can significantly reduce the incidence of these fractures.
